This section provides information about the library files installed with Vericut ("library" folder in your Vericut installation). Library files are included in every installation, and include:
General Purpose Library Files¶
The following types of General Purpose Library Files are included:
Vericut default files — Default files opened by Vericut. The files are configured to perform a short simulation when Play is pressed. Two sets of files provide demonstrations for inch (vericut.*) and metric (vericutm.*) environments.
Vericut initialization files — Initialization files opened by Vericut via File tab > New Project. Two sets of files provide initialization for inch (init.*) and metric (initm.*) environments.
Library Control Files¶
Library Control Files are example NC machine controls intended to help you configure Vericut for simulating G-Code NC Programs that run on popular NC machining centers composite, tape laying machines or automatic drilling and fastener machines.
Library Machine Files¶
Library Machine Files are example NC machines intended to help you configure Vericut for simulating G-Code NC Programs that run on popular NC machining centers and composite tape laying machines.
The files available in the above categories will vary depending on whether you are using Vericut or Vericut Composite Simulation.
